Step 1: Understanding the Concept:
Heat transfer in the Earth-atmosphere system occurs through three primary physical mechanisms: conduction, convection, and radiation.
These processes redistribute solar energy and drive global weather systems.

Step 3: Detailed Explanation:

Let us analyze the thermodynamics of each term:
1. Convection:
This refers to the transfer of heat by the actual, bulk movement of a fluid (such as air or water).
When the Earth's surface is heated by solar radiation, the air directly above it becomes warm, less dense, and buoyant.
This warm air rises vertically into the cooler layers of the atmosphere, creating convective currents that transport both mass and sensible/latent heat.
Thus, this is the correct mechanism.
2. Conduction:
This is the transfer of heat through molecular collisions within a solid or between substances in direct contact, without any bulk movement of the material.
Since air is a poor thermal conductor, conduction is only significant in the thin layer of air in direct contact with the ground.
Thus, Option (B) is incorrect.
3. Advection:
This refers to the horizontal transfer of heat, moisture, or other properties by the wind.
Unlike convection, advection is a lateral movement.
Thus, Option (C) is incorrect.
4. Sublimation:
This is a phase change where a substance transitions directly from a solid to a gas phase (such as ice to water vapor) without passing through the liquid phase.
It is not a bulk heat transport mechanism.
Thus, Option (D) is incorrect.
